Introduction

The title “Primary 4 English Language PDF Worksheet” immediately identifies the resource’s target audience: students in Primary 4, typically around 9-10 years old. At this crucial stage of development, a solid foundation in English language skills is paramount for success in all academic areas. This type of worksheet serves as a valuable tool for solidifying classroom learning and providing targeted practice in key areas like grammar, vocabulary, reading comprehension, and writing. Printable worksheets, particularly those available in a convenient PDF format, offer flexibility for use at home or in the classroom, allowing for focused reinforcement of essential concepts.

Worksheet Features and Educational Activities

The “Primary 4 English Language PDF Worksheet” presents information in a structured and easily digestible format, ideal for young learners. The layout typically includes a combination of question types designed to engage different learning styles. One might find multiple-choice questions that test vocabulary or grammar concepts. Fill-in-the-blank exercises could challenge students to use correct verb tenses or prepositions. Matching activities might pair words with their definitions or synonyms. Furthermore, short writing prompts can encourage creative expression and reinforce sentence construction skills. Questions and exercises are arranged to build in difficulty, ensuring students progressively master the material. Clear, concise directions guide students through each task. Scaffolding hints are often incorporated to provide gentle support without giving away the answer directly. The inclusion of visually appealing elements, like themed illustrations or simple diagrams, can maintain student engagement and clarify concepts. The design emphasizes age-appropriateness, with a visually organized layout thats easy for students to navigate independently or with minimal adult assistance.
